Tomohiro Yara
Summary
Tomohiro Yara is a human[1]. He was born on January 1, 1962[2]. He worked as a politician[3].

Personal Life
Political affiliations include Liberal Party[10], a defunct political party[22], in Japan[23], founded in 2012[24], headquartered in Kōjimachi[25]; Democratic Party for the People[11], a defunct political party[26], in Japan[27], founded in 2018[28], headquartered in Nagatachō[29]; Constitutional Democratic Party of Japan[12], a political party[30], in Japan[31], founded in 2020[32], headquartered in Miyakezaka Building[33]; and Centrist Reform Alliance[13], a political party[34], in Japan[35], founded in 2026[36], headquartered in Nagatachō[37].
